Fantastic news reported by The Guardian today that the the sponge on a string / capsule sponge / swallowable sponge is as effective as an endoscopy in identifying a precursor condition to oesophageal cancer, a Less Survivable Cancers Taskforce cancer.

We welcome this commitment to increasing research funding for cancers with the lowest survival rates. The Less Survivable Cancers Taskforce cancers have an average 5yr survival rate of just 16% - that's unacceptable. We'll be calling on other parties to make similar pledges & drive up survivalπ
